Overturned Truck Closes Lane on Mariscal Sucre Avenue in Quito

Africa2 hr ago

An overturned truck caused the closure of one lane on Mariscal Sucre Avenue in Quito, Ecuador. Specialized personnel responded to the incident to manage the situation and ensure road safety. The authorities coordinated actions to mitigate any disruption caused by the accident. The specific details of the truck's cargo or the cause of the overturning were not immediately available. Emergency services were on-site to facilitate the cleanup and removal of the vehicle. The incident highlights the importance of rapid response in traffic accidents to prevent further complications. Efforts were made to maintain traffic flow as much as possible during the operation. The objective was to restore normal conditions on the avenue swiftly.
